Alepo

Alepo provides core network software and digital enablement solutions for telecommunications service providers to manage 5G, 4G, Wi-Fi, and IoT networks while automating billing and customer management processes.

Alepo

<p>Alepo provides the digital backbone you need to launch and manage advanced telecommunications services. Whether you are deploying 5G, expanding fiber networks, or managing public Wi-Fi, you can use this platform to handle everything from core network functions to complex subscriber billing. It simplifies the way you monetize data by providing real-time charging and policy control tools that adapt to your specific business model.</p> <p>You can automate the entire subscriber lifecycle, from initial onboarding and self-care to automated invoicing and support. The software helps you bridge the gap between complex network infrastructure and the digital experience your customers expect. By consolidating your business and operation support systems, you can reduce manual overhead and launch new data plans or services in a fraction of the time usually required by legacy systems.</p>

Amdocs

<p>Amdocs offers a comprehensive suite of cloud-native software designed specifically for the communications and media industries. You can manage the entire customer lifecycle, from initial service discovery and ordering to real-time billing and ongoing support. The platform helps you transition to 5G and cloud environments while simplifying complex back-office operations like revenue management and network automation. </p> <p>By using these tools, you can create more personalized experiences for your subscribers and launch new digital services faster. The software is built for large-scale service providers and enterprises that need to handle massive data volumes and complex global networks. You get a modular architecture that lets you pick the specific capabilities you need, whether that is digital commerce, automated operations, or advanced data analytics.</p>
